Nemours is seeking a Vice President, HR Business Partners. The VP of HR Business Partners will have a strong focus on HR Business Partner Management and lead and enhance the services provided to the enterprise.
The VP will be a strategic thought partner driving HR excellence within the respective regions.
This role will be instrumental in aligning HR strategies with business goals.
The VP will create and implement sustainable people-centric solutions that advance whole child health and the healthiest workforce while enabling a high-performing culture.
In this role, you will utilize expertise in leading, developing and coaching the HR Business Partners.
You will partner closely with internal and external legal counsel on risk mitigation strategies.
You will also build trust and relationships with associates at all levels within the organization and leverage strong strategic thinking and leadership to enhance culture, engagement and retention. Essential Functions : Act as a trusted advisor to regional leadership teams to shape and influence future business strategies.
Key advisor to sensitive and complex issues.
Builds a strong relationship with client groups and amongst Human Resources. Develop and execute an HRBP strategy that aligns with overall business objectives and people strategies. Drive a culture of collaboration, agility, and high performance across all HRBP-led initiatives. Partner with HRBPs to assess talent needs and develop targeted solutions for associate growth and retention.
Partner with Culture & Talent on development of frameworks that empower associates and leaders to be their authentic and best self. Guide HRBPs in leading organizational change including but not limited to restructuring, mergers, cultural transformation.
Foster a proactive people-centric approach that supports leaders and associates in navigating change and driving results. Ensure HRBPs effectively manage associate relations, performance management, workforce planning and LOAs. Ensure that policies and practices comply with local, state and federal employment laws. Partner with CoEs to ensure seamless HR service delivery.
